Eniola Badmus Hails Tinubu For Moving Nigeria's Economy Forward 

By Oluwarantimi Oludase 

Popular Nollywood actress, Eniola Badmus has showered praises on President Tinubu for moving Nigeria's economy forward.

The actress, who is also the Special Adviser on Social Events and Public Hearing to the Speaker, House of Representatives, Tajudeen Abbas, has lauded the President for increasing exporting of products.

She stated that the changes the president has made has moved Nigeria from just consumers to producers.

She made this known on her Instagram story:
“Our imports are reducing, and our exports are increasing. That is a sign that our economy is expanding.

“For the year-to-date 2024, our imports were N24.44 trillion, while our exports stood at N38.59 trillion. This gives us an unprecedented trade surplus of over N14 trillion in just eight months.

“It has never happened in Nigeria. Never. This is a refreshing shift from consumption to production.”
